From 69cf2b1ed059b8eed4740ba76d73bf4c195c1775 Mon Sep 17 00:00:00 2001 From: zuoxiao <470321431@qq.com> Date: 星期三, 08 一月 2025 14:10:59 +0800 Subject: [PATCH] 添加虚拟卡时添加二次确认 --- pages/rechargeCard/rechargeCard.wxml | 1 + pages/rechargeCard/rechargeCard.js | 19 ++++++++++++++++++- 2 files changed, 19 insertions(+), 1 deletions(-) diff --git a/pages/rechargeCard/rechargeCard.js b/pages/rechargeCard/rechargeCard.js index 9377c0c..53ee238 100644 --- a/pages/rechargeCard/rechargeCard.js +++ b/pages/rechargeCard/rechargeCard.js @@ -47,7 +47,8 @@ "vcNum": "200030000000" }], showDialog: false, - isWXRefreshing: false + isWXRefreshing: false, + isAddCardDialog:false }, // 鍒囨崲 Tabs switchTab: function (e) { @@ -190,8 +191,24 @@ showDialog: false }) }, + + + //娣诲姞铏氭嫙鍗� handleClick() { + this.setData({ + isAddCardDialog: true + }) + }, + cancelDialog(){ + this.setData({ + isAddCardDialog: false + }) + }, + addCardPost(){ + this.setData({ + isAddCardDialog: false + }) wx.showLoading({ title: '姝e湪娣诲姞璇风◢鍊�...', // 鍔犺浇鎻愮ず鏂囧瓧 mask: true // 鏄惁鏄剧ず閫忔槑钂欏眰锛岄槻姝㈣Е鎽哥┛閫忥紝榛樿涓� false diff --git a/pages/rechargeCard/rechargeCard.wxml b/pages/rechargeCard/rechargeCard.wxml index 55234ff..c5d9583 100644 --- a/pages/rechargeCard/rechargeCard.wxml +++ b/pages/rechargeCard/rechargeCard.wxml @@ -63,4 +63,5 @@ </view> <t-fab icon="gesture-add" text="娣诲姞铏氭嫙鍗�" bind:click="handleClick" bind:move="handleMove" aria-label="澧炲姞" usingCustomNavbar draggable y-bounds="{{[0, 32]}}" style="--td-primary-color-7:#2D8BF7"></t-fab> <t-dialog visible="{{showDialog}}" content="鎮ㄨ繕鏈変綑棰濇湭浣跨敤锛屽闇�閿�鍗★紝璇峰厛浣跨敤瀹屾垨閫�娆惧悗鎵嶅彲鎿嶄綔銆�" confirm-btn="{{ confirmBtn }}" bind:confirm="closeDialog" /> + <t-dialog class="dialog" visible="{{isAddCardDialog}}" content="纭娣诲姞铏氭嫙鍗″悧锛�" confirm-btn="{{ { content: '纭', variant: 'base', theme: 'danger' } }}" close-on-overlay-click="false" cancel-btn="鍙栨秷" bind:confirm="addCardPost" bind:cancel="cancelDialog" /> </view> \ No newline at end of file -- Gitblit v1.8.0